There's clearly a discrepancy in the date format that needs to be fixed. Lack of attention to detail will get you dinged. Never put only one word on a new line.

I see the problem with the inconsistent date format and attention to detail, but I'm not too sure I understand what you mean by "never put only one word on a new line." Can you please elaborate.

Thank you for your advice.

 
Take_It_To_The_Bank

If you are writing a bullet point, make sure the sentence does not end with one word on a new line. That looks bad and creates too much whitespace.
